A few years ago, Audi pulled the plug on the V12 TDI engine it offered on the Q7. Sure, it had 500 horsepower and made the big SUV go really fast, but it also came with unreasonable fuel consumption. Who in their right mind would ever buy a V12 SUV, right? But Mercedes doesn't play by the same rules as Audi does, so it did the exact opposite.
Over a year ago, they rocked the premium car market with the G63 AMG, the SUV everybody wanted but didn't know yet. From celebrities to football players and just about anybody else who could afford one, the twin-turbo V8 monster became a smashing success story. However, the guys in Affalterbach had even more devious plans, including the first-ever G-Class with a V12 engine, also launched in 2013.
If the G-Class is the flagship of the Mercedes SUV range, this is the flagship of the flagship range then! The twin-turbo V12 is shared with some of the biggest headline grabbers Mercedes has ever made, including the SL65 AMG and S65 AMG.
Because they're as expensive as supercars and drink a lot of fuel, most G65 AMG models are shipped off to the Emirates, the place where they best belong. So imagine our surprise when we discovered this one locked away in a British showroom with so many features on show and a relatively attractive price tag.
Underneath that sexy metallic brown paint sits a full body kit from German tuning specialists Brabus. They haven't gone bonkers with the car and changed just enough so that the G65 became more muscular. There's a carbon hood scoop, bigger alloys and reshaped front bumper. The interior is dressed in a combination of brown and black, which isn't going to be to everyone's taste.
The seller, Pegasus Auto House, was established in 2008 as a provider of luxury automobiles or customers around the world. They want no less than £202,000 (€256,300) for this very rare and powerful machine and we think it's totally worth it, considering it's only got 6,800 miles (11,000 km) on the clock.
